.vc_tta-color-sky.vc_tta-style-outline .vc_tta-panel .vc_tta-panel-heading{
	border-color:#05bdde !important;
	    border-left: none;
    border-right: none;
    border-radius: unset;
	border-width:1px;
	border-bottom:unset;
}
.vc_tta-color-sky.vc_tta-style-outline .vc_tta-panel:last-child
.vc_tta-panel-heading{
		//border-bottom:1px solid;
}



.vc_tta-color-sky.vc_tta-style-outline .vc_tta-panel .vc_tta-panel-title>a{
		color:#303030 !important;

}
.vc_tta-color-sky.vc_tta-style-outline .vc_tta-panel .vc_tta-panel-heading{
	color:#303030 !important;
}
.vc_tta-color-sky.vc_tta-style-outline .vc_tta-panel .vc_tta-panel-heading:hover{
	background:none !important;
	color:#303030 !important;
}
.vc_tta-color-sky.vc_tta-style-outline .vc_tta-panel .vc_tta-panel-body{
	border:0 !important;
}

@media (min-width: 992px)
{
#footer-main .col-lg-6:first-child {
		width:25% !important;
	}
	#footer-main .col-lg-6:last-child {
		width:75% !important;
	}
	
	#footer .footer-main {
    padding-top: 20px;
    padding-bottom: 20px;
}
}


#engage-contact-form .btn,.wpcf7-submit{
	font-size:18px !important;
	line-height:1.5 !important;
}

.wpb_wrapper video{
	margin-top:-3rem !important;
	height:auto;
}


.page-id-711566 .vc_toggle_arrow,.page-id-711380 .vc_toggle_arrow {
	margin: auto !important;
    text-align: center !important;
}

.widget_recent_entries ul > li > a{
	color:#000000;
}

.widget_recent_entries ul > li > .post-date{
	color:#828282;
	font-size:13px;
}

@media (max-width: 768px)
{
.page-content video{width: 100%    !important;
  height: auto   !important;
	}
}


body.page-id-711488 .vc_tta-title-text{
	text-transform:capitalize;
	font-size:1.5rem;
}

.section-page .wpb_content_element.vc_custom_1607300515322, .section-page .wpb_content_element.vc_custom_1607300389872{
	margin-top:-1.5rem !important;
}


.vc_tta.vc_general .vc_tta-panel-title>a::after{
	border-style: solid;
	border-width: 0.1em 0.1em 0 0;
	content: '';
	display: inline-block;
	height: 0.5em;
	left: 0.5em;
	position: relative;
	vertical-align: top;
	width: 0.5em;
		top: 0.25rem;
	transform: rotate(135deg);
}

.vc_active .vc_tta-panel-title>a::after{
		transform: rotate(-45deg) !important;
			top: 0.5rem !important;
}

.wpcf7-submit, .veented-slide-buttons a.btn-custom{
	font-size:18px !important;
	font-family:Arial, Helvetica, sans-serif;
}

#page-title .blog-meta{
	display:none;
}

.post-type-archive-tribe_events:not(.page-template-page-php) #page-title{
	display:inline-table; !important;
}

.tribe-common--breakpoint-medium.tribe-events .tribe-events-c-search__button{
	background:#01afd1 !important;
}
tribe-common--breakpoint-medium.tribe-events .tribe-events-c-ical__link:hover{
	background:#01afd1 !important;
	color:#ffffff;
}
.tribe-common--breakpoint-medium.tribe-events .tribe-events-c-ical__link{
		color:#01afd1;
	    border: 1px solid #01afd1;
}
.tribe-common .tribe-common-c-svgicon{
	color:#01afd1;
}

.tribe-events .tribe-events-c-ical__link:hover {
		background:#01afd1 !important;
	color:#ffffff;
}

.tribe-common--breakpoint-medium.tribe-events .tribe-events-c-nav__next, .tribe-common--breakpoint-medium.tribe-events .tribe-events-c-nav__prev,.tribe-common--breakpoint-medium.tribe-events .tribe-events-c-nav__next-label-plural, .tribe-common--breakpoint-medium.tribe-events .tribe-events-c-nav__prev-label-plural{
	color:#333;
}

#page-title{
	background:#ffffff !important;
}
#page-title.page-title-with-bg h1{
	margin-left:1rem;
}

#page-title h1:before{
  display: inline-block;
  margin: 0;
  content: "";
  text-shadow: none;
  color:#1bbfdf;
  width: 30px;
  height: 30px;
  left: 0;
  vertical-align:inherit;
	margin-right:0.5rem;
	background-image:url(/wp-content/uploads/2020/12/title-star.svg);
	background-repeat:none;
	position:absolute;
	top:5px;
}

#page-content p{
	line-height:25px 
}
.page-title .breadcrumbs a, #page-title .blog-meta li a{
	color:#000 !important;
}

.tribe-events .tribe-events-calendar-month__day--current .tribe-events-calendar-month__day-date{
	color:#01afd1;
}

.footer-widget .custom-html-widget p{
	
	margin:0;
	font-family:'Times New Roman', Times,serif;
	font-size:16px;
	line-height:1.5;
}

@media (min-width: 1000px)
{
.footer-widget .textwidget{
	height:60px;
	position:relative;
 	}
	.footer-widget .textwidget h6{
		position:absolute;
		font-size:14px;
		bottom:0;
		margin:0;
		max-width:65%;
	}
}

.vc_custom_1607570950727 .widget_search{
	padding-left:1rem;
}
.vc_custom_1607570950727 .search-form{
	max-width:95%;
	display:flex;
}
.vc_custom_1607570950727 .search-form .search-submit{
	max-width: 65px;
    padding: .3rem 0rem;
    margin-left: 1rem;
	background-color:#112d51;
}
.vc_custom_1607570950727 .search-form .search-submit:hover{
		background-color:#01afd1;
border-color:#01afd1;
}

}
.page-id-711488 .owl-item .vc_grid-item-mini{
	background:#f6f4f1;
}
.page-id-711488 .owl-item .vc_grid-item-zone-c-right .vc_gitem-animated-block{
	width:35%;
}
.page-id-711488 .owl-item .vc_grid-item-zone-c-right .vc_gitem-zone-c{
	width:60%;
	padding-top:1rem;
}
.vc_btn3-container.vc_btn3-inline{
	width:95%;
}
.vc_btn3.vc_btn3-color-sky, .vc_btn3.vc_btn3-color-sky.vc_btn3-style-flat{
	background-color:#00afd1;
	float:right;
}
.vc_btn3.vc_btn3-color-sky:hover{
		background-color:#00afd1;
}


@media (min-width: 768px)
{
	#pojo-a11y-toolbar{
		top:57px;
	}
	.header-scroll-full #main-navigation .nav-left{
	display:none !important;
}
.header-scroll-full #header .main-nav, #sticky-nav{
	height:auto !important;
	padding:0.5rem 0;
} 

.header-scroll-full .main-nav, .header-scroll-full .main-nav #main-menu > ul > li > a, .header-scroll-full #main-navigation .nav-tools li a{
	height:auto !important;
}
}
.owl-item .post-excerpt p{
	display:none;
}
.owl-item .post-info{
	padding:20px 20px 5px 20px;
}

.vc_custom_1607570950727{
	padding-top:15px !important;
}
.vc_custom_1607570950727 .search-textbox{
	margin-bottom:0px !important;
}

@media (min-width: 600px){

body.page #main-content{
	border-top:35px solid #ded6c4;
	padding-top:1rem;
}
body.home #main-content{
	border-top:0;
	padding-top:0rem;
}
}
@media (max-width: 600px){
	body.home .btn.btn-xlarge{
		padding:1rem;
	}
	#page-title.page-title-with-bg .page-title-wrapper{	border-top:35px solid #ded6c4;
			padding-top:1rem !important;

}
	#page-title.page-title-with-bg h1{
		margin-left:1.5rem;
	}
	#page-title h1:before{
		left:10px;
	}
	}


.single-post #page-title h1:before{
	background:none;
}
.hurrytimer-timer-block{
	display:flex !important;
	flex-wrap:wrap;
	flex-direction:row;
}
.hurrytimer-timer-digit{
	background:#fff;
	padding:6px;
	border-radius:3px;
	color:#000 !important;
	font-weight:bold;
}
.hurrytimer-timer-label{
		color:#fff !important;
line-height:1.5;
	margin-left:5px;
}
.hurrytimer-timer-sep{
	display:none !important;
}
.hurrytimer-headline{
	color:#fff !important;
}

.vc_tta-title-text{
	font-size:1.5rem;
}

.vc_custom_1610940826815 ::marker ,.vc_custom_1610941464831 ::marker, .vc_custom_1611013852839 ::marker,.vc_custom_1611013769226 ::marker{
	color:#ffffff;
}

@media (max-width: 600px){
	.header-dark #logo img.logo-white{
		height:100px !important;
	}
	#pojo-a11y-toolbar .pojo-a11y-toolbar-toggle a{
		font-size:150% !important;
	}
	.content-below-header > .section-page {
		padding-top: 120px !important;
	}
	.header-scroll-full #main-navigation,#main-navigation{
		height:120px !important;
	}
	.m-sticky + #main-content #page-title:not(.page-title-parallax){
		margin-top:120px !important;
	}
	.vc_custom_1610939483506 h1 > span{
		color:#000000 !important;
	}
		 .mobile-black{
		//color:#000 !important;
	}
	.btn-accent3{
		background-color:#00b0d1 !important;
	}
	 h3.mobile-black{
	//	color:#000 !important;
	}
.vc_custom_1608436922825{
	background-size:contain !important;
	background-repeat:no-repeat !important;
	background-color:#003150 !important;
	background-position: top center !important;
	min-height:32rem !important;
	}
	
	.hurrytimer-sticky{
		padding-top:0 !important;
		padding-bottom:0 !important;
	}
	.pr_widget_social_icons{
	float:none !important;
		text-align:center;
		margin-bottom:0 !important;
}
	.footer-main p{
		margin:auto !important;
	}
	.footer-main{
		padding-top:1rem !important;
		padding-bottom:1rem !important;
	}
	.footer-main .widget{
		margin-bottom:0 !important;
	}
	
.vc_column_container>.vc_column-inner.vc_custom_1607667691871{
		padding-top:9rem !important;
	}
}

.pr_widget_social_icons{
	float:right;
}

.tribe-events-page-template h1,.post-type-archive-tribe_events h1,.search-results h1{
	font-size:32px !important;
	color:#003150 !important;
	margin-left:1rem;
}

@media (max-width: 600px){
.tribe-events-page-template h1, .post-type-archive-tribe_events h1{
    margin-left: 1.5rem !important;
	}
}

#scholar-img{
	max-width:80%;
	margin:auto;
	padding-bottom:1rem;
}
 
.footer-widget-col-1 .textwidget p  > span{
	display:block;line-height:1.5;
} 


body.home #readspeaker_button189{
	display:none !important;
}

.footer-widget-col-1 span{font-family:'Times New Roman', Times,serif;}

@media (min-width: 768px){
#footer-main .col-md-6:first-child{
	width:37% !important;
}
#footer-main .col-md-6{
	width:31.5% !important;
	}
}

.hurrytimer-sticky-inner{
	color: #ffffff;
}

#video1{
	padding-top: 30px;
}

#main-content{
	min-height: 975px;
}

.vc_gitem_row .vc_gitem-col{
	background-color: #c1e2e5;
}

.vc_btn3.vc_btn3-color-juicy-pink, .vc_btn3.vc_btn3-color-juicy-pink.vc_btn3-style-flat{
	background-color: #0f2d4f;
}

.vc_btn3.vc_btn3-color-juicy-pink, .vc_btn3.vc_btn3-color-juicy-pink.vc_btn3-style-flat:hover{
	background-color: #000000;
}

.vc_gitem_row .vc_gitem-col{
	height: 300px;
}

.news h4{
	color: #0f2d4f;
}

.vc_btn3.vc_btn3-color-sky, .vc_btn3.vc_btn3-color-sky.vc_btn3-style-flat{
	background-color: #0f2d4f;
}